Some photos from the Justice For Elijah #BlackLivesMatter march in Melbourne today. The rally was angry but never out of control, and there were at most 300 people. The march ended at Flinders street station, and waiting for us were units of mounted coppers, as well as officers in body armor. Freaking body armor! There were at least 10 kids under 16 up the front of the march, and that's what was waiting for them. The rally was totally peaceful of course. There was a lot of rage from the elders who spoke, but nothing that was inciting people to violence. Nothing that warranted a mini army that's for sure.
